Bond has prevented numerous nuclear weapons being used (Thunderball, Goldfinger, Spy Who Loved Me, Octopussy, Goldeneye, The World is Not Enough, etc.). And Never Say Never Again, which doesn't really count.

Promoted solar power (The Man With the Golden Gun), and used a sailing ship at the end.

Used public transport (trains)

Prevented two space based lasers from coursing a great deal of damage (Diamonds Are Forever, and Die Another Day)

Prevented oil pollution (View to a Kill, and I think the World is Not Enough also).

Although as you say, he's used plenty of fast cars, planes, and helicoptors. But in caparison is a small impact.

Prevented World War 3 in You Only Live Twice (although there was a volcanic eruption).



Meanwhile, Independence Day - the heroes actually used a nuclear weapon, after the aliens trashed half the planet. Added to the vomit that no doubt was produced by much of the audience, it was a most un-green film.
